Qatar Red Crescent Society (QRCS) has completed a project to control COVID-19 pandemic in the Republic of Tajikistan, by supporting the poor families worst affected by the virus in Dushanbe. The project is aimed at providing urgent hygiene items to the most vul- nerable people of Tajikistan. The Red Crescent Society of Tajikistan dis- tributed hygiene kits, disinfectants, and medical masks to 1,200 vulnerable families (around 3,200 persons) from different pandemic-affected groups, mainly the patients who are taking treatment in local hospitals of Tajikistan.
